In a combination of art and technology, Rooster lighting collaborates with Brisbane based artists Michael Candy and Meagan Streader. The installation on the monument of Gasworks Plaza in Newstead, Brisbane, Australia won the 2014 Australia NewZealand Engineering Society (IESANZ) Queensland Best Lighting Design Award.

Lighting Design 

Customised LEDs that resemble clouds are the interactive feature of the luminaire which respond to the way people move around the installation. A total of 10 different cloud shaped luminaires are suspended from the outer structure of the century old converted gas drum.  Cameras are installed on each luminaire to collect the movements of those in the vacinity. These movements are converted into electronic signals to control the way the lights perform.

The unique installation gives the historical monument a fresh look. As the monument becomes more populated with people and their movements, the more the lighting installations will flicker.
